#f38fce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f38fce is composed of 95.3% red, 56.1%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.2% magenta, 15.2%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 322.2 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 75.7%. #f38fce color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e71f9d.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

● #f38fce color description : Very soft pink.
#f38fce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f38fce has RGB values of R:243, G:143,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.15,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15962062.

Shades and Tints of #f38fce
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0108 is the darkest color, while #fef9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#f38fce
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c3bfc2 is the less saturated color, while #fd85d0 is the most saturated one.
